This photograph captures the majestic view of the cupola of the papal tribune, adorned with St. Peter's See, in all its grandeur. At the bottom of this breathtaking sight stands Bernini's bronze canopy, a masterpiece that adds an exquisite touch to Saint Peter's Cathedral in Vatican City. The image takes us back to around 1890 when it was captured, showcasing the timeless beauty and architectural brilliance that has stood for centuries. The artwork itself dates back even further, created between 1656 and 1665 by none other than Gian Lorenzo Bernini (1598-1680), one of history's most renowned artists. Intriguingly, amidst this heavenly scene lies an allegory: a representation of the Holy Spirit depicted as a cloud floating above. This abstract concept symbolizes divine presence and spiritual guidance within Saint Peter's Cathedral. Adding to its charm are angelic figures known as putti scattered throughout the composition.
